To me, my friend, there are THREE SOLUTIONS for you. Like you, I want STABLE/FAST rom, with lot of memory free, with good battery life and such.

Check my advice; I have flashed over 240 roms (!!!) and every single phone available! And when I'm saying "I have flashed", I mean I'm TESTING the rom for 2-3 days before I port another (most of users, just watching the new rom and if they don't like something, immediately are flashing another).

Here is my advice ("with best choice order")...

A) Select FIRST a good and suitable to you (your country, area, mobile provider company)... PHONE (radio)! Do so! It's very important... I recommending XBIC1 or PUJA1 (I'm using the 1st one).

;) CHOOSE a rom from the list bellow:

6.1 firmwares

-----------------

01) First (and best) choice is... Khuanchai's 21001 build (ported from OMNIA II)... To me, the best 6.1 on this... plannet!

02) Krazy Radd's DXID1 G-ROM S9-Lite, PagePool 10.

03) Ryrzy 21054 build (Normal, Lite or M2D, all are fine).

04) Shokka9's SHKvRC LITE or M2Dv2... Shokka9's DXID1 SHKv99.

6.5 firmwares

-----------------

01) First (and best) choice is... AGAIN... Khuanchai's "Hybrid IF1 23016-21928" - UltraLite or M2D classic, Page Pool 6!

02) The VERY SAME build rom, but from Ryrzy - R6.5v4L 23016 (Lite ver) or R6.5v4L 23016 (Lite+M2D)! Same/similar benifits, some different things (like NeoTitanium, for a change).

03) OCK's build 21889 UltraLite v2.

04) Khuanchai's "3-in-1" build 21928, Page Pool 6.

05) Khuanchai's IF1 build 23028 UltraLite-M2DL, Page Pool 6.

06) Nicklashidegard's build 21896 - FloTanium (21-03-10).

07) Nicklashidegard's build 21893 - Classic Lite Fixed (02-03-10).

08) Sector's DXID1 "Zeus" build 23009 - Lite.

09) Shokka9 DXID1 SHKv17 or 18 or 23, Classic or M2D.

10) Anzo's build 28227-23526-28205 v.4, all PFC.

Of course, you need to port FavHack or Advance Configuration Tool and play along with the tweaks and make your rom even better.

Believe me, friend, I gave you the BEST STABLE/FAST roms around!!! I'm talking about STABILITY/SPEED (and good battery life)! Perhaps there are many other better roms in several other points, but I gave you MY CHOICES for stability/speed/good battery life.
